When it comes to selling your home, the price is one of the most significant factors. Although a well-maintained and desirable property can certainly attract buyers, a high price tag can be a serious hindrance. Buyers are wary, and they're prepared to pass on a property if the price seems out of line with similar homes in the locality.
- Think about the present real estate trends in your area.
- Analyze your home's price with recent transactions of comparable properties.
- Speak with a qualified real estate professional to get an accurate assessment
By setting a competitive price, you can maximize your chances of attracting serious buyers and concluding your home in a timely style

Pricing your home
When it comes to selling your house quickly, your pricing tactics plays a crucial role. A well-thought-out valuation can attract potential purchasers and fuel competition, leading to a faster sale.
Overpricing your home can scare away buyers, while failing to maximize your return can result in leaving value on the table.
- Seek advice from a local expert who understands the current market trends.
- Research comparable sales in your area to get a realistic estimate of value.
- Be willing to adjust your price based on buyer feedback and market conditions.
By finding the right balance, you can maximize your home quickly and for the best possible return.
